Abstract

Streaming to a terminal by using a duplicating switch to receive a stream of data units, using the duplicating switch to store content from the stream, using the duplicating switch to generate a second stream that incorporates the content that was stored and address information corresponding to more than one terminal whose addressing information was not part of the first stream, and using the duplicating switch to make the second stream of data units available to two or more terminals.

Claims (44)

1. A computer-implemented method for streaming electronic data to one or more user terminals, comprising:

receiving a request from a first user terminal for a stream of electronic data;

decoding, with a processor, the stream of electronic data from a first communications protocol;

duplicating the decoded stream of electronic data;

encoding, with a processor, the duplicated stream of electronic data using a second communications protocol; and

sending the encoded stream of electronic data to the first user terminal.

2. The computer-implemented method of claim 1 , further comprising storing the decoded stream of electronic data at a duplicating device.

3. The computer-implemented method of claim 2 , further comprising storing header information in association with the decoded stream of electronic data.

4. The computer-implemented method of claim 2 , further comprising storing a checksum describing content contained within the decoded stream of electronic data.

5. The computer-implemented method of claim 1 , further comprising:

receiving a request from a second user terminal for the stream of electronic data;

associating a first pointer with the request from the first user terminal and a first portion of the decoded stream of electronic data; and

associating a second pointer with the request from the second user terminal and a second portion of the decoded stream of electronic data.

6. The computer-implemented method of claim 1 , further comprising tracking which portions of the encoded stream of electronic data have been sent to the first user terminal.

7. The computer-implemented method of claim 1 , further comprising:

receiving a pause message from the first user terminal; and

pausing the sending of the encoded stream of electronic data to the first user terminal in response to the pause message.

8. The computer-implemented method of claim 7 , further comprising:

receiving a resume message from the first user terminal; and

resuming the sending of the encoded stream of electronic data to the first user terminal in response to the resume message.

9. The computer-implemented method of claim 8 , wherein the sending of the encoded stream of electronic data to the first user is resumed beginning at a point indicated in the pause message.

10. The computer-implemented method of claim 8 , wherein the sending of the encoded stream of electronic data to the first user is resumed beginning at a point indicated in the resume message.
